Serving clients around Virginia, M. Barkley Horn is an empathetic and dedicated attorney handling cases in personal injury. Working from her office at Blankingship & Keith, P.C., in Fairfax, Virginia, she represents clients in matters of automobile and trucking accidents, brain injury, products liability, sex abuse and wrongful death, among others. She approaches each case diligently, ensuring her clients feel heard and provides strategic counsel to maximize their remuneration.
Pursuing her legal education after completing her undergraduate studies in history from The George Washington University, Ms. Horn honed her skills in litigation and developed a passion for advocating for those who have suffered injustices. She earned her Juris Doctor from George Mason University Antonin Scalia Law School in 2021 and in the same year, was admitted to the Virginia State Bar. She first gained experience as an intern at the Fairfax County Circuit Court, where she observed court proceedings, wrote bench memorandums and conducted research for civil cases.
Currently, Ms. Horn approaches her practice with a deep passion for advocating for individuals who have been victims of someone else’s negligence. Additionally, she dedicates a significant part of her practice to combating institutional shortcomings that compromise safety and cause preventable harm. Recently she was a part of the counsel that won a $7 million settlement in a wrongful death case involving a construction site accident in which a ground-level worker was killed when a crowbar fell from more than 100 feet above.
Ms. Horn’s commitment to the field of personal injury has been lauded by her peers. She was recognized by Best Lawyers: Ones to Watch in Personal Injury Litigation-Plaintiffs in 2016. She was also named on the Legal Elite Young Lawyers list by Virginia Business magazine. Additionally, she was named as one of the Up and Coming Lawyers by the Virginia Lawyers Weekly in 2025.
